Transaction aeb43dd795e6f58592415e316b7ab9cf7ef20c810da2eca035fddf7f89ac7431
1 Input
2 Outputs
- aeb43dd795e6f58592415e316b7ab9cf7ef20c810da2eca035fddf7f89ac7431:0
- aeb43dd795e6f58592415e316b7ab9cf7ef20c810da2eca035fddf7f89ac7431:1
value 1230060
address 3K1h3SHr8Cpf542kircoRr6Uusp9xCc763
value 152168284
address 34TYcHACxdJj8LJ2KmtsNQs2Z5XpbX3MXX